Browse
Employers / Recruiters

Senior Java Backend Developer

xrex · 30+ days ago
Negotiable
Full-time
Apply

We are building and expanding a Backend team!

Want to develop the best crypto products ever, right here in Taiwan, and offer them to millions of users worldwide?

Want to be based in Taiwan but work in a silicon-valley-like environment, and release world-class products?

Want to work with some of the world's best front end and full-stack developers?

Come change the world with us! Join this fast-growing startup founded by software veterans and funded by top VCs, banks, public companies, and the Taiwanese government (NDF)!

We’re hiring for very experienced back-end developers who have an eye for performance, utility and practicality rather than regurgitating programming patterns from textbooks. Ideally, you will have experiences in both a) Java and in b) AWS current tech such as Lambda & Serverless programming, programmed infrastructure, and DevOps as a philosophy.

Other than Java, the exact mix of other skills does not matter, so long as your tool chest includes a mix of abilities. Be willing to attack anything that comes your way, learn on the fly and get things done. Come talk to us if you love engineering and want to push your skill set in a dynamic fast-paced environment.

Responsibilities:

  • Develop and build robust, scalable, clean and understandable server code.
  • Design and implement RESTful APIs that is simple, intuitive, easy to test and fit to
    business requirements.
  • Troubleshoot, debug and optimize server code.
  • Design and maintain well-structured, scalable and efficient database schemas.
  • Write API documentation for API users, server documentation for Ops users.
  • Participate and collaborate with functional teams.
  • Take ownership and responsibility for our backend development activities.
  • Report to Backend Team Leader.

Requirements:

  • 6+ years experience in backend code developing role.
  • Strong Java, Spring / Spring Boot development experience.
  • Strong technical development experience on effectively writing code, best practices code refactoring and GoF Design Patterns.
  • Proven problem solving and analytical skills.
  • Excellent knowledge of RDBMS such as MySQL.
  • Knowledge of RESTful APIs is a must.
  • Knowledge of NoSQL such as Redis, MongoDB, DynamoDB.
  • Experience using Git / Git Flow to manage asynchronous collaboration across teams.
  • Experience in Agile development lifecycle methodology.
  • Moderate English.
  • The skills assist the company in resolving technical issues concerning customer's accounts or company software infrastructure. A Technical Support Engineer will also support computer software integration by diagnosing and troubleshooting common problems.

Good to have:

    • Experience in AWS cloud computing services.
    • Experience in Python, Go and micro-services development.
    • Experience with API documentation tools such as Swagger.
    • Knowledge with database versioning tools such as Flyway, LiquiBase.
    • Knowledge with CI/CD deployment flow.
    • Experience in building large, scalable distributed systems with good understanding of
      microservices architecture and associated principles.
    • Knowledge of managing data consistency in distributed systems.
    • Experience working with asynchronous systems.

    Location: Taipei (check us out on Google Maps!)

    About XREX

    Regarding our culture

    Last updated on Feb 6, 2019

    See more

    About the company

    Recently posted jobs

    Analyzing

    Taipei City

     · 

    30+ days ago

    Taipei City

     · 

    30+ days ago

    Taipei City

     · 

    30+ days ago

    Taipei City

     · 

    30+ days ago

    Taipei City

     · 

    30+ days ago

    More jobs like this

    Analyzing

    Taipei City

     · 

    30+ days ago

    New Taipei City

     · 

    30+ days ago

     · 

    30+ days ago

     · 

    30+ days ago

    Taipei City

     · 

    29 days ago

     · 

    30+ days ago

    Taipei City

     · 

    30+ days ago

    Developed by Blake and Linh in the US and Vietnam.
    We're interested in hearing what you like and don't like! Live chat with our founder or join our Discord
    Changelog
    🚀 LaunchpadNov 27
    Create a site and sell services based on your resume.
    🔥 Job search dashboardNov 13
    Revamped job search UI with a sortable grid, live filtering, bookmarks, and application tracking.
    🫡 Cover letter instructionsSep 27
    New Studio settings give you control over AI output.
    ✨ Cover Letter StudioAug 9
    Automatically generate cover letters for any job.
    🎯 Suggested filtersAug 6
    Copilot suggests additional filters above the results.
    ⚡️ Quick applicationsAug 2
    Apply to jobs using info from your resume. Initial coverage of ~200k jobs in Spain, Germany, Austria, Switzerland, France, and the Netherlands.
    🧠 Job AnalysisJul 12
    Have Copilot read job descriptions and extract out key info you want to know. Click "Analyze All" to try it out. Click on the Copilot's gear icon to customize the prompt.
    © 2023 RemoteAmbitionAffiliate · Privacy · Terms · Sitemap · Status